Aerial Imagery Analysis: With a 30% share, aerial imagery analysis plays a significant role in crop monitoring and management.
This skill involves interpreting and analysing drone-generated images to assess crop health and growth patterns. 2.
Precision Agriculture: Accounting for 25% of the market, precision agriculture is the application of advanced technology to ensure efficient and sustainable farming practices.
It includes crop yield estimation, soil analysis, and variable rate application of fertilizers based on crop demand. 3.
Crop Health Monitoring: With a 20% share, crop health monitoring is a crucial aspect of drone-based surveillance of crops.
It entails using advanced sensors and drones to monitor the health of crops and detect signs of distress, such as pests, diseases, or nutrient deficiencies. 4.
Data Processing and Analysis: Data processing and analysis account for 15% of the market.
This skill involves processing and analysing vast amounts of data collected from drones to make informed decisions about crop management and agricultural practices. 5.
UAV Operation and Maintenance: UAV (Unmanned Aerial Vehicle) operation and maintenance account for 10% of the market.
It involves the safe and efficient operation and maintenance of drones used for crop surveillance, ensuring optimal performance and longevity.
